Driftgate performs schema migrations on the Opaline platform using the expand–migrate–contract pattern, so releases never require downtime. The release manager should only invoke break-glass access if a contract phase strands traffic on a dropped column and automated rollback fails. Break-glass grants direct DDL rights on the primary for one hour, fully audited. Announce the action in the release channel first. The break-glass console unlocks with the recovery passphrase listed directly below.

unlock words, kawig-bawef: belax-sorir-druax-ulaiel-wenael-belael

## Escalation — GalleriaGuide App

If the audio-stream token service fails auth checks twice in 15 minutes, page the on-call via the Halcyon rotation. Do not restart the token signer without approval; key rotation state may be mid-cycle. Capture logs from the exhibit-sync gateway first. Severity 1 applies if visitor devices receive another patron's session. For security-relevant escalations, contact the app security lead directly.

alerts address for kajog-tadup: druox@plorvanet.internal

## Changelog — Datewright 2.4

Heads up: we renamed LOCALE_FMT to DATEWRIGHT_LOCALE_FORMAT so it stops colliding with the shell builtin on some boxes. Old name still works until 3.0 but logs a warning. While you're auditing the env file anyway, note that the localization API now requires auth, and its credential goes on the very next line.

sealed setting: ARCHIVE_KEY3=8d0

## Changelog — Ticktrace 1.9

### Renamed: DRIFT_API_TOKEN
During the cron drift investigation we found plugins confusing this variable with the metrics token, so it has been renamed to indicate it authorizes drift-report uploads specifically. Plugin authors must read the new name from 1.9 onward; the old name is ignored without warning. Sample env files in the SDK are updated. In your deployment env file, the drift-report upload secret is set on the next line.

env line for fawef-taguf: VAULT_KEY13=a9695905a9a90